What is acidity constant? How is it expressed.

Answer»

SOLUTION :(i) The dissociation constant is generally called acidity constant because it measures the RELATIVE strength of an acid. The STRONGER the acid, the large will be its `K_(a)` value.
(ii) The strength of carboxylic acid can be EXPRESSED in terms of the dissociation constant `(K_(a))`:
`R^(-)COOH+H_(2)OhArrRCOO^(-)+H_(3)O^(+)`
`K_(a)=([RCOO^(-)][H_(3)O^(+)])/([RCOOH])`
(III) The dissociation constant of an acid can also be expressed in terms of `p^(Ka)` value.
`p^(Ka)=-logK_(a)`

The wave number of the shortest wavelength transition in the Balmer series of H atom is

Answer»

`27419.5cm^(-1)`
`219356cm^(-1)`
`12186.2cm^(-1)`
`24372.4cm^(-1)`

SOLUTION :`barv=109678 [1/(n_(1)^(2))-1/(n_(2)^(2))]`
`n_(1)=2,n_(2)=OO`
`barv=109678 [1/(2^(2))-1/(oo^(2))]`
`=109678/4=27419.5cm^(-1)`
